The Mechanics of Chimney Makeovers

A chimney is a complex system of flues, vents, and caps that work together to draw smoke and gases out of your home. When a chimney is functioning properly, it's a beautiful and efficient way to heat your home. However, when it's in disrepair, it can be a safety hazard and a nuisance.

Chimney makeovers typically involve inspecting and repairing or replacing damaged or worn-out components, such as flues, caps, and crowns. This process can be a DIY project or a professional undertaking, depending on the extent of the damage and the homeowner's comfort level.

The Signs of a Failing Chimney

Here are the top 10 signs that indicate your chimney needs a makeover:

  • The most obvious sign is smoke leaking into your home. This can be a sign of a cracked or damaged flue, or a poorly fitted cap.
  • Water damage around the chimney or fireplace is another common sign of a failing chimney. This can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ards.
  • Dirt and debris accumulation is a sign that your chimney is not functioning properly and is in need of a good cleaning and maintenance.
  • Discoloration or chipping of the chimney or fireplace surround is a sign that the masonry is deteriorating and requires repair.
  • Rust or corrosion on metal components is a sign that your chimney is exposed to the elements and requires protection.
  • Uneven or sagging of the chimney or fireplace is a sign that the structure is compromised and requires repair or replacement.
  • Unusual odors or sounds coming from the chimney are a sign that there's a problem with the flue or venting system.
  • If you notice sparks or embers falling into the fireplace, it's a sign that the chimney is not functioning properly and requires attention.
  • Age and wear and tear are natural signs that your chimney needs a makeover, especially if it's been in use for over 20 years.
  • Finally, if you're experiencing frequent chimney repairs or cleaning, it may be time to consider a full-scale makeover to address the root causes of the issues.
